Anyway. Yes, you will have no problem hooking your PC to your amps directly if all your speakers are powered your amps. Some factory installs power the front speakers off the dash unit, and a seperate amp for the back. You might also want to check the voltage expectation on the audio inputs of your amps. Some amps are hooked on to an amplified signal. In this case you migh need a pre-amp.
